Dan Wesson Pistols

Dan Wesson is a well-known firearms manufacturer that produces high-quality revolvers and pistols. They are renowned for their accuracy, reliability, and craftsmanship. Dan Wesson pistols are made using high-quality materials and feature a variety of finishes and calibers.

One of the most popular Dan Wesson pistols is the DWX. The DWX is a combination of the Dan Wesson 1911 and the CZ 75. It features a lightweight aluminum frame and a stainless steel slide. The DWX is chambered in 9mm, making it an excellent choice for self-defense.

Another popular Dan Wesson pistol is the Guardian. The Guardian is a compact 1911 that is designed for concealed carry. It features a lightweight aluminum frame and a stainless steel slide. The Guardian is chambered in .45 ACP, making it an excellent choice for self-defense.

Ruger Pistols

Ruger is a popular firearms manufacturer that produces a wide range of pistols, revolvers, and rifles. They are renowned for their reliability and affordability. Ruger pistols are made using high-quality materials and feature a variety of finishes and calibers.

One of the most popular Ruger pistols is the Ruger LC9s. The LC9s is a compact pistol that is designed for concealed carry. It features a polymer frame and a stainless steel slide. The LC9s is chambered in 9mm, making it an excellent choice for self-defense.

Another popular Ruger pistol is the Ruger SR1911. The SR1911 is a full-size 1911 that is designed for target shooting and self-defense. It features a stainless steel frame and slide. The SR1911 is chambered in .45 ACP, making it an excellent choice for self-defense.

Dan Wesson Pistols vs. Ruger Pistols

When it comes to choosing between Dan Wesson pistols and Ruger pistols, there are a few factors to consider. Here are some of the pros and cons of each brand:

Dan Wesson Pistols Pros:

  • High-quality craftsmanship and materials
  • Accurate and reliable
  • A variety of finishes and calibers to choose from

Dan Wesson Pistols Cons:

  • More expensive than Ruger pistols

Ruger Pistols Pros:

  • Affordable
  • Reliable
  • A variety of finishes and calibers to choose from

Ruger Pistols Cons:

  • Not as high-quality as Dan Wesson pistols
  • May not be as accurate as Dan Wesson pistols

The choice between Dan Wesson pistols and Ruger pistols comes down to personal preference and budget. If you're willing to pay more for a high-quality firearm, then a Dan Wesson pistol may be the best choice for you. If you're looking for an affordable and reliable firearm, then a Ruger pistol may be the better option.
